Code to handle centering and tiling of Emacs frames

;; Functions to work with frames | |
(provide 'ime-frame) | |
(defun screen-usable-height (&optional display) | |
"Return the usable height of the display. | |
Some window-systems have portions of the screen which Emacs | |
cannot address. This function should return the height of the | |
screen, minus anything which is not usable." | |
(- (display-pixel-height display) | |
(cond ((eq window-system 'ns) 22) | |
(t 0)))) | |
(defun screen-usable-width (&optional display) | |
"Return the usable width of the display. | |
This works like `screen-usable-height', but for the width of the display." | |
(display-pixel-width display)) | |
(defun frame-sort-ltr (frames) | |
"Sort frames by their visual order, left to right. | |
This method takes a list of frames, and returns that list, sorted | |
by the visual display order. This is determined by comparing the | |
left position of the frames; the leftmost frames are returned | |
first." | |
(sort frames (lambda (framea frameb) | |
(< (frame-parameter framea 'left) | |
(frame-parameter frameb 'left))))) | |
(defun frame-box-get-center (w h cw ch) | |
"Center a box inside another box. | |
Returns a list of `(TOP LEFT)' representing the centered position | |
of the box `(w h)' inside the box `(cw ch)'." | |
(list (/ (- cw w) 2) (/ (- ch h) 2))) | |
(defun frame-get-center (frame) | |
"Return the center position of FRAME on it's display." | |
(let ((disp (frame-parameter frame 'display))) | |
(frame-box-get-center (frame-pixel-width frame) (frame-pixel-height frame) | |
(screen-usable-width disp) | |
(screen-usable-height disp)))) | |
(defun frame-center (&optional frame) | |
"Center a frame on the screen." | |
(interactive) | |
(apply 'set-frame-position | |
(let* ((frame (or (and (boundp 'frame) frame) (selected-frame))) | |
(center (frame-get-center frame))) | |
`(,frame ,@center)))) | |
(defun frame-tile-horizonal () | |
"Tile visible frames horizontally. | |
This function tiles visible frames, distributing them evenly | |
across the display, and centering them vertically. | |
It doesn't know about multi-head displays, and will probably fail | |
dramatically if used in such an environment." | |
(interactive) | |
(let ((pos) | |
(offset 0) | |
(vwidth (/ (screen-usable-width) (length (visible-frame-list))))) | |
(dolist (frame (frame-sort-ltr (visible-frame-list))) | |
(setq pos (frame-box-get-center (frame-pixel-width frame) | |
(frame-pixel-height frame) | |
vwidth (screen-usable-height))) | |
(set-frame-position frame (+ offset (car pos)) (cadr pos)) | |
(incf offset vwidth)))) | |
(defun frame-tile-center-horizonal () | |
"Tile visible frames horizontally, center-weighted. | |
Rather than tiling frames evenly across the available width of | |
the display, this function tiles them into the center of the | |
display, adding a 2% margin in between frames. | |
It doesn't know about multi-head displays, and will probably fail | |
dramatically if used in such an environment." | |
(interactive) | |
(let* ((framewidth (apply '+ (mapcar 'frame-pixel-width (visible-frame-list)))) | |
(margin (/ (screen-usable-width) 50)) ;; = (/ s-u-w *.02) = 2% | |
(totalwidth (+ framewidth (* margin | |
(- (length (visible-frame-list)) 1)))) | |
(offset (car (frame-box-get-center totalwidth 0 (screen-usable-width) | |
(screen-usable-height))))) | |
(dolist (frame (frame-sort-ltr (visible-frame-list))) | |
(set-frame-position frame offset (cadr (frame-get-center frame))) | |
(incf offset (+ margin (frame-pixel-width frame)))))) |
